Located in the St. Paul Public School District at 30 East Baker St in St. Paul, MN, Humboldt High School serves grades 6-12 and has an enrollment of roughly 1091 students. Frequently Asked Questions about St. Paul
How much are Studio apartments in St. Paul?
There are currently 1,056 Studio Apartments in St. Paul with rent ranges from $629 to $2,370 with an average price of $1,235.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om St. Paul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in St. Paul ranges from $665 to $4,078 with an average monthly rent of $1,503.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in St. Paul c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in St. Paul range from $549 to $6,078.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,831.
How expensive are St. Paul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 274 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in St. Paul on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$437 to $6,459 - averaging $2,073 for the location.
